Subscription or perpetual: which Trados Studio license is right for you?

New customers can now access the latest version of Trados Studio through subscription. Customers who already own a perpetual Studio 2021 or 2022 license may upgrade to the latest version, Studio 2024, on a perpetual license. New perpetual Studio licenses are no longer available to purchase.
 
Both subscription and existing perpetual licenses provide access to the same core Studio features and functionality. 
 
Subscription 
 
Our subscription plans offer flexible payment options, making them ideal for freelancers and organizations with changing needs. The available plans vary depending on whether you're using Trados Studio Freelance or Trados Studio Professional: 
 
Trados Studio Freelance: 
  • Monthly: Rolling monthly contract. 
  • Annual: Monthly payments with a 12-month commitment. 
  • Annual Saver: One annual payment with a 12-month commitment. 
 
Trados Studio Professional: 
  • One annual payment with a 12-month commitment.
 
Benefits of a subscription: 
  • Lower upfront cost compared to a perpetual Studio license. 
  • 14-day risk-free period for Freelance subscriptions - cancel within the first two weeks if it’s not right for you. 
  • Always access the latest version, with automatic updates and upgrades included. 
  • Easily add extra licenses (ideal for growing teams). 
  • Option to cancel at the end of each contract term. 
 
Note: Subscription licenses provide access to Trados Studio for the duration of your plan - you do not own the software outright. 
 
Perpetual Studio licenses for existing customers
 
New perpetual Studio licenses are no longer available to purchase. However, if you already own a perpetual Studio license, you retain permanent use of your current version.
 
What this means for existing perpetual Studio license holders: 
  • You continue to own the license permanently. 
  • You receive updates and service releases for your purchased version (while supported). 
  • Freedom to upgrade to the latest version for an additional fee. 
 
This option remains suitable for customers who have already purchased a perpetual Studio license and prefer long-term ownership without recurring payments.
 
Which option is right for you? 
 
If you're a freelance translator, or part of a team with changing workloads or need the ability to scale quickly, a subscription may offer all the flexibility you need. If you already own a perpetual Studio 2021 or 2022 license and prefer a one-time investment model, upgrading your existing license to Studio 2024 may be the better option.
